Publication number: 20130199274Abstract: Provided are a leakage inspection apparatus and a leakage inspection method for inspecting the flow rate of leakage from a tested body disposed in a tested-body chamber 21. The leakage inspection apparatus includes liquid supplying and pressurizing means 11 for supplying a probe liquid to the inside of the tested-body chamber 21 and pressurizing the probe liquid to a high pressure 0.1 MPa or more, vacuum evacuation means 22-b, 23-b and a quadrupole mass spectrometer 34. The tested body 21 is evacuated, the probe liquid is supplied to the inside of the tested body and pressurized to 0.1 MPa or more and the concentration of a probe medium leaked from the tested body and evaporated in a vacuum is measured by the quadrupole mass spectrometer 34, thereby measuring the flow rate of leakage from the tested body. This makes it possible to determine the flow rate of leakage using a liquid as a probe medium and simultaneously possible to perform a pressure tightness inspection at an atmospheric pressure of 0.Type: ApplicationFiled: July 1, 2011Publication date: August 8, 2013Applicants: MARUNAKA CO., LTD., YAMAGUCHI UNIVERSITYInventors: Setsuo Yamamoto, Hiroki Kurisu, Naoki Takada, Mitsugu Nakagawa, Katsushi Tsuge, Yukihiro Ishikawa

Patent number: 8339390Abstract: Provided are a power supply circuit and a display device which are capable of enhancing power efficiency even when applied to a display panel whose current consumption varies. The power supply circuit boosts and outputs an input voltage using a booster chopper circuit. A frequency control circuit changes a frequency of a clock signal, which controls a switch of the chopper circuit, in accordance with a load of the power supply circuit. The frequency control circuit divides an operation of the display device into a display effective period at a high load and a vertical retrace period at a low load, based on a vertical synchronizing signal and a horizontal synchronizing signal. The frequency control circuit sets the frequency of the clock signal in a high-load period to be higher than that in a low-load period.Type: GrantFiled: November 25, 2009Date of Patent: December 25, 2012Assignees: Hitachi Displays, Ltd., Panasonic Liquid Crystal Display Co., Ltd.Inventors: Naoki Takada, Naruhiko Kasai, Takuya Eriguchi, Yuki Okada, Mitsuru Goto, Yoshihiro Kotani
